Gor Mahia beat Leones Vegetarianos 2-0 in the African Champions League preliminary round first leg at Machakos’ Kenyatta Stadium Saturday.

Kevin Omondi “Ade” and Ephrem Guikan scored for the hosts against the Equatorial Guineans, who were largely dominated the entire game.

Omondi put the coach Dylan Kerr’s side in the lead in the 19th minute firing past Leones’ goalkeeper Sapunga Manuel from close range following a superb combination with Meddie Kagere.

Humphrey Mieno missed from the spot to deny K’Ogalo the chance to double their lead in the 27th minute. The match ended 1-0 at the breather.

Kerr made early substitutions introducing Sammy Onyango for George Odhiambo but it was Ivorian Ephrem’s introduction in place of Omondi that made immediate impact in the 60th minute.

The former AS Port Louis striker scored on his first touch unleashing a left foot thunderbolt at the right to make it 2-0 for Gor.

A few minutes later he forced Sapunga to a fine fingertip over from another venomous shot.

Gor created more scoring chances but could not convert them as the match ended 2-0.

The Kenyan champions will travel to Malabo for the second leg in a week’s time. The aggregate winner proceeds to the 1st round of the premium interclub competition.
